Step-by-step explanation:
To factor the expression 8x + 12 using the GCF (Greatest Common Factor), we need to find the largest number that can evenly divide both 8x and 12. In this case, the GCF is 4. So, we can rewrite the expression as 4(2x + 3). This is the factored form of the expression.
